05 2022 档案

摘要:文章目录什么是dom事件流dom事件流的三个阶段冒泡阶段处理程序捕获阶段处理程序如何阻止事件捕获/冒泡0级,2级事件什么意思目标阶段事件流的根节点?什么是dom事件流DOM(文档对象模型)结构是一个树型结构,当一个HTML元素产生一个事件时,该事件会在元素节点与根结点之间的路径传播,路径所经过的结点 阅读全文
posted @ 2022-05-30 12:22 我歌且谣 阅读(38) 评论(0) 推荐(0) 编辑
摘要:事件冒泡&事件捕获 例如,父元素和子元素都绑定了点击事件,点击了子元素。子元素和父元素都会触发点击事件。 三个div都绑定了事件,点击最里面的div 事件冒泡:由内到外触发(内层div事件->中间div事件->外层div事件) 事件捕获:由外到内触发(外层div事件->中间div事件->内层div事 阅读全文
posted @ 2022-05-30 10:18 我歌且谣 阅读(116) 评论(0) 推荐(0) 编辑
摘要:audio.src 与 audio.getAttribute('src') 取值并不相同,后者为准 阅读全文
posted @ 2022-05-28 23:27 我歌且谣 阅读(24) 评论(0) 推荐(0) 编辑
摘要:<!DOCTYPE html> <html> <head> <style> </style> </head> <body> <div id="d1">a123</div> <div id="d2"> b 123 0 </div> <script> let d1 = document.querySel 阅读全文
posted @ 2022-05-28 11:54 我歌且谣 阅读(9) 评论(0) 推荐(0) 编辑
摘要:原文链接:https://blog.csdn.net/weixin_49335800/article/details/112509190 访问原文 1.django中的三种路径 1.1 操作系统文件绝对路径django 静态文件查找, 模板查找(第一种)# 去配置好的 文件夹 中查找指定的文件BAS 阅读全文
posted @ 2022-05-27 20:13 我歌且谣 阅读(410) 评论(0) 推荐(0) 编辑
摘要:0<-1<2 js中返回true Python中返回False 阅读全文
posted @ 2022-05-26 21:30 我歌且谣 阅读(29) 评论(0) 推荐(0) 编辑
摘要:for(var i=arr.length-1; i<=0; i--){ }; var new_arr = arr.reverse(); 阅读全文
posted @ 2022-05-24 12:43 我歌且谣 阅读(42) 评论(0) 推荐(0) 编辑
摘要:from django.http import JsonResponse views.py def fun(r): return JsonResponse(数据) 阅读全文
posted @ 2022-05-23 11:29 我歌且谣 阅读(164) 评论(0) 推荐(0) 编辑
摘要:区别: 1、ajax提交是异步进行,网页不需要刷新,而from表单提交需要刷新; 2、ajax必须要用js来实现,而Form表单不是必须; 3、ajax需要使用程序来对其进行数据处理,Form表单提交是根据表单结构自动完成,不需要代码干预。 form表单提交与 ajax提交的区别 1、使用场景: 安 阅读全文
posted @ 2022-05-22 23:26 我歌且谣 阅读(478) 评论(0) 推荐(0) 编辑
摘要:number(tag) 如果参数可以转化为数字,就转化, 否则返回NaN, 参数true返回1, false返回0 Number.isInteger() 方法用来判断给定的参数是否为整数。 string.replace(/ /g, '') 去除字符串空格 阅读全文
posted @ 2022-05-22 21:13 我歌且谣 阅读(32) 评论(0) 推荐(0) 编辑
摘要:box-shadow 属性用于在元素的框架上添加阴影效果。你可以在同一个元素上设置多个阴影效果,并用逗号将他们分隔开。该属性可设置的值包括阴影的X轴偏移量、Y轴偏移量、模糊半径、扩散半径和颜色。 阅读全文
posted @ 2022-05-20 14:41 我歌且谣 阅读(117) 评论(0) 推荐(0) 编辑
摘要:<!DOCTYPE html> <html> <head> <style> * {margin: 0;} .demo{background-color: aquamarine; padding: 1px; height: 300px;} .demo>div{width: 0px; height: 0 阅读全文
posted @ 2022-05-19 22:06 我歌且谣 阅读(114) 评论(0) 推荐(0) 编辑
摘要:box-sizing: border-box; 阅读全文
posted @ 2022-05-19 21:42 我歌且谣 阅读(25) 评论(0) 推荐(0) 编辑
摘要:<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>demo</title> <style> #example1 { border: 10px dotted black; padding:35px; background: yell 阅读全文
posted @ 2022-05-19 15:45 我歌且谣 阅读(22) 评论(0) 推荐(0) 编辑
摘要:background 可以设置 背景颜色、背景图片、定位等 ;而background-color 只能设置 背景颜色 ,设置时仅仅改变了背景色,但此时有一个默认的的background:repeat;而设置background: #aaa;后,相当于同时设置了background:no-repeat 阅读全文
posted @ 2022-05-19 15:35 我歌且谣 阅读(50) 评论(0) 推荐(0) 编辑
摘要:a {text-decoration: none;}去下划线ul , ol {list-style: none;}去掉小圆点 / 去掉数字 阅读全文
posted @ 2022-05-19 10:46 我歌且谣 阅读(87) 评论(0) 推荐(0) 编辑
摘要:audio如果不添加controls , 默认样式,所包含音频和文字都不会显示。 阅读全文
posted @ 2022-05-19 10:15 我歌且谣 阅读(159) 评论(0) 推荐(0) 编辑
摘要:设置父元素font-size: 0; 阅读全文
posted @ 2022-05-19 02:24 我歌且谣 阅读(29) 评论(0) 推荐(0) 编辑
摘要::first-child 选择器匹配其父元素中的第一个子元素。 阅读全文
posted @ 2022-05-18 22:12 我歌且谣 阅读(7) 评论(0) 推荐(0) 编辑
摘要:<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title></title> <style> *{margin: 0; font-size: 0px;} .d1{height:300px; background-color: gray; } 阅读全文
posted @ 2022-05-17 21:05 我歌且谣 阅读(1149) 评论(0) 推荐(0) 编辑
摘要:两种定时器 setInterval(一直执行) setTimeout(只执行一次) 阅读全文
posted @ 2022-05-17 19:50 我歌且谣 阅读(210) 评论(0) 推荐(0) 编辑
摘要:原因: 行内块元素的默认对齐方式是:与文字的基线对齐。元素加入文字,导致没有加入文字的行内块元素对齐到文字的基线。 解决方法: 方法1.修改行内块元素对齐方法:加入:vertical-align: top;方法2:没有文字的元素加入 文字,以毒攻毒。 <!DOCTYPE html> <html la 阅读全文
posted @ 2022-05-17 16:21 我歌且谣 阅读(189) 评论(0) 推荐(0) 编辑
摘要:1、修改内容: 3种方式修改内容a. 获取或赋值元素的HTML内容: 元素.innerHTML b. 获取或赋值元素的纯文本内容: 元素.textContent c. 获取或赋值表单元素的值: 表单元素.value如:input.vaue可获取或填写输入框内的文本 2、修改属性: 3种 a. 字符串 阅读全文
posted @ 2022-05-16 22:52 我歌且谣 阅读(579) 评论(0) 推荐(0) 编辑
摘要:innerHTML说明 阅读全文
posted @ 2022-05-16 13:59 我歌且谣 阅读(14) 评论(0) 推荐(0) 编辑
摘要:DocumentFragment DocumentFragment,文档片段接口,一个没有父对象的最小文档对象。它被作为一个轻量版的 Document 使用,就像标准的document一样,存储由节点(nodes)组成的文档结构。与document相比,最大的区别是DocumentFragment 阅读全文
posted @ 2022-05-16 13:22 我歌且谣 阅读(35) 评论(0) 推荐(0) 编辑
摘要:推测,添加应该有两种类型, 一种是创建的新的、在DOM树之外的元素 / 节点添加到DOM树中 , 一种是将已存在DOM树中的元素 / 节点添加到其它元素 / 节点 。 第一种:创建新元素/节点 。 通过 createElement()创建新元素节点,也可通过此方法自定义标签。 如: let div 阅读全文
posted @ 2022-05-15 23:01 我歌且谣 阅读(2193) 评论(0) 推荐(0) 编辑
摘要:删除元素有两种方法。 1、 我删我自己, 要删除的元素 . remove() 2、从父节点删除, 父元素 . removeChild(要删除的元素) 经测试发现,不论那种方式,被删除的元素,并非完全消失,只是不存在DOM中,却存在文档碎片中。 如需再次使用,需先添加到DOM树中。 如通过append 阅读全文
posted @ 2022-05-15 19:59 我歌且谣 阅读(865) 评论(0) 推荐(0) 编辑
摘要:<div tx = "123" id="brand" class="huawei mi" name="num"> <span class="s"></span> </div> 1、如何通过标签获取元素 。 通过标签名字,借助 getElementsByTagName 。 如:let spans = 阅读全文
posted @ 2022-05-15 13:14 我歌且谣 阅读(180) 评论(0) 推荐(0) 编辑
摘要:DOM,前端核心方法最终都是要落实到元素上的,这里的元素 = 标签 + 内容 + 样式。 即,不论CSS还是JavaScript,都围绕元素进行操作。 HTML标签携带了: 特性 和 样式。 特性由HTML本身提供。所以HTML视角,可以通过特性和标签名查找元素。 样式由CSS通过选择器提供。所以C 阅读全文
posted @ 2022-05-15 10:37 我歌且谣 阅读(30) 评论(0) 推荐(0) 编辑
摘要:启动mysql服务即可,步骤如下: 1、右击计算机 2、点击管理 3、双击服务和应用程序 4、双击服务服务 5、找到mysql,启动此服务 (win7、win10操作相同) 阅读全文
posted @ 2022-05-13 19:30 我歌且谣 阅读(1015)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示